The Federal government has assigned various identifying codes to each community, county and state. At one time or another, the US Census Bureau has used one (or more) of the following identifiers when referring to either Centre County or the community of Farmers Mills:
- The GNIS Codes ...
- The current system of identification is called the Geographic Names Information System (GNIS). The following GNIS codes relate to Farmers Mills:
- GNIS ID for Farmers Mills: 1203554
- GNIS ID for Centre County: 1214720
- GNIS ID for Commonwealth of Pennsylvania: 1779798
- Misc. Census Codes ...
- Farmers Mills is located in Census Region #1 (the Northeast Region) and Division #2 (the Middle Atlantic Division).

| <1> | It's a common practice for mapmakers to remove the apostrophe from possessive names. So Farmers Mills may originally have been Farmer's Mills. Sometimes the trailing 's' might be dropped altogether, in which case Farmers Mills might be written as Farmer Mills. For more information, please visit our Genealogy Helper Page for Farmers Mills. |
